BACKGROUND:
The City applied for federal funding in the March 2020 Kane-Kendall Council of Mayors (KKCOM) Call for Projects for 11 different projects. Nine (9) of the City's 11 submitted projects were selected to be in KKCOM's 5-year program. This project was not selected to be in the original KKCOM 5-year program and was placed in the Contingency Program. Since that time the project has received funding and has moved into the program, but the full funding amount requested has not yet been received. The funding ratio for these projects is 75/25 (75% federal / 25% local) for Construction and Construction Engineering, up to a maximum amount of $2,500,000. At the moment this project has secured a little over $1,000,000. The City applied for additional funds through CMAP in early 2023 (results pending) and could obtain additional funds from KKCOM if other projects do not move forward in the program.

The project will include widening Sullivan Road from Edgelawn Drive to West of Randall Road from two to three lanes and enclosing the drainage system. Also included will be intersection improvements at Randall Road with signal modernization, and other resurfacing along Sullivan Road. The project will also fill in sidewalk gaps with additional connections and add a shared use path.
